Sinopse

JUST AS THE AUTHOR DECIDES TO COMMIT SUICIDE, he is interrupted by an unknown woman. This woman, Lena, saves him from the suicidal action and disappears from the place where they were. He
then starts desperately looking for her in the city
of San Pedro. When he finds her, he discovers
that she had met, through Baruch, through a metaphysical encounter, the God of Spinoza. Lena, then, using her story, also lived in Atacama, presents this God, called Nature, to the author
